68 Aql is a B-type (Blue-White) star located in the constellation Aquila. It carries the designation 68 Aql.

Located approximately 602.9 light-years from Earth, 68 Aql res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

68 Aql is classified as a spectral class B star (B-type (Blue-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

68 Aql has an apparent magnitude of +6.12,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of -0.049.
